Abstract
The competitive interaction between the Immune System and tumours is very complex, being non-linear and, to some extent, evolutionary. A fundamental aspect of this evolution is the asynchronous process of mutual learning of the two populations involved — the tumoural and the immune cells. In this work, to describe them, we propose a simple non-linear family of super-macroscopic models with non-monotonically time-varying coefficients. Numerical simulations of transitory phases complement the theoretical analysis.
